Tempo Matters

The strategic use of music in casinos goes beyond mere background noise. It is a carefully curated element designed to evoke specific emotions and responses from players. The tempo, genre, and even the specific tracks chosen all play a crucial role. You want to create an atmosphere that complements the overall theme of the casino.

One of the fundamental aspects of casino musicology is tempo. The speed of the music has a direct impact on the pace of gameplay and player behavior. Upbeat and energetic tempos are often employed in areas with high-energy games like slots and craps. This creates a sense of excitement and urgency. On the other hand, slower tempos are used in lounges or areas with more relaxed games. It encourages players to take their time and savor the experience.

What’s the Genre?

The genre of music is another key element in crafting the casino experience. Different genres evoke distinct emotions, and casinos leverage this to create specific atmospheres. For example, jazz and blues may be chosen for a sophisticated and classic ambiance. At the same time, electronic or pop music may infuse a modern and vibrant energy. The goal is to align the musical genre with the casino’s theme and target audience.

Pop Hits Make the Chips Win

The specific tracks selected play a crucial role in establishing a connection with players. Casinos often invest in licensing popular or iconic songs that resonate with a broad audience. These familiar tunes trigger a sense of nostalgia or evoke positive emotions, creating a more enjoyable and memorable gaming experience. The soundtrack becomes a soundtrack of memories, associating the casino visit with the emotions elicited by the music.

Cha-Ching!

In addition to setting the tone and pace of the gaming floor, casino musicology extends to specific moments in gameplay. The introduction of bonus rounds, jackpot wins, or free spins is often accompanied by celebratory tunes, heightening the thrill of victory. Conversely, somber melodies may accompany losses or near misses, contributing to the emotional rollercoaster that is inherent in gambling.

Behaviors Chosen for Your

The impact of casino musicology is not limited to player enjoyment; it also influences behavior. Studies have shown that the right music can encourage players to stay longer, spend more, and even take more risks. The tempo and genre of the music can influence the perception of time, creating an environment where players lose track of it, leading to extended play sessions.
